Welcome to Amaroo Village

At Amaroo Village you’ll find a wonderfully relaxed and fulfulling lifestyle that offers a range of activities and aged care services designed to stimulate and care for your mind and body.

Since its foundation in the late 1960s, Amaroo Care Services (formerly Amaroo Cottages for Senior Citizens Inc, known as Amaroo Village) has established a reputation for outstanding residential aged care and independent living services, as well as a strong commitment to creating a secure, relaxed and fulfilling lifestyle for seniors.

Management Profiles

Management

David Fenwick, Chief Executive Officer

David Fenwick is Chief Executive Officer of Amaroo Village. David has been with Amaroo since 2002, he has 16years of managerial experience in WA rural health services, including being General Manager of Central Great Southern Health Service and previously the Mid West Health Service.These GM roles involved establishing and managing Multi Purpose Service centres.   David has publications on health and aged care to his credit and has implemented the development of several world-class residential aged care facilities in regional Western Australia. He has a Bachelor of Arts in Politics, Philosophy & Sociology / Public Administration and a Graduate Diploma in Health Policy and Management.  David is an Associate Fellow of the Australian College of Health Service Executives.

Nicole Martino, Corporate Services Manager

Nicole Martino is Amaroo Village's Corporate Services Manager. Nicole has a Bachelor of Business in Accounting from Edith Cowan University. She has over 15 years experience in private industry covering both financial and managerial accounting. Her strength lies in developing and managing efficient accounting departments.

John Hansen, Property & Assets Manager

John Hansen is Amaroo Village's Property and Services Manager. John is a registered builder and has over 35 years experience in building and property services. John also has a Diploma in Building and a Diploma in Teaching. Previously, he was the Manager for the maintenance of all defence bases throughout WA and in addition lectured part-time in building studies at TAFE

Allan Reed, Resident Services Manager

Allan Reed is Amaroo Village's Residential Services Manager. Allan has more than 26 years experience in Local Government in middle and senior management roles involving staff and financial management. Allan also has a Diploma in Local Government (Clerk) and has undertaken training in Staff Management, Time Management and Emergency Evacuation Procedures.

Heidi Bond, Operational Support Manager

Heidi Bond is Amaroo Village's Operational Support Manager. Heidi has over 15 years experience in the Administration field and has an Advanced Diploma in Business Administration. She has undertaken various Human Resources and Management courses and attends regular network meetings. As a part of her role Heidi oversees Amaroo’s Human Resources and Information Technology operations and has been with Amaroo since 2002.

 

Carol Leyshon, Residential Care Manager – Buckley Caring Centre

Carol Leyshon is Amaroo's Residential Care Manager, at Buckley Caring Centre. Carol is a Registered Nurse and has over 25 years nursing experience. Carol commenced her management career as Care Centre Co-coordinator at McMahon Caring Centre in June 2006 and has since undertaken the management role at Buckley Caring Centre
